Chief Many Horses
Many Horses was a Blackfoot Indian leader of the 19th century. He was also known as Little Dog and Heavy Shield.
(It was very common for Plains Indian men to have multiple names during their lifetime. "Many Horses" was the name he
became best known by due to the unusually large herd of horses he acquired in his life.) Many Horses was a chief of the Piegan,
or Piikani, tribe of Blackfoot. His birthdate was not recorded, but he died in battle against the Crows in 1867.
